A PE liner distinguishes this 93*93*120 U-panel polypropylene bag for powder packing. Its virgin PP body combines side-seam loops with separate filling and discharge spouts in the industrial container format.

U-Panel Body with a PE Interior Liner

The outer bag uses virgin polypropylene in a U-panel shape. The PE liner is a separate component to consider alongside the powder characteristics and the intended packing process.

Powder Entry and Discharge Connections

The top filling spout provides an inlet above the U-panel body. A discharge spout below creates a separate outlet, with side-seam loops completing the lifting arrangement around this lined powder container.

For the 93*93*120 option, review the body size independently of both equipment connections. The liner and outer PP fabric contribute different specification details, so the intended powder and packing arrangement should be discussed before choosing this particular U-panel configuration.

Printing for the Lined Powder Format

Offset printing can be specified according to customer requirements. Include the identification artwork with the PE-lined body and paired-spout arrangement when preparing the order details for this powder-packing FIBC.
